White Flame Symbolism in Different Cultures
The white flame meaning varies across cultures, but it consistently represents purity, protection, and divine guidance. In many ancient traditions, white flames were seen as sacred and were often used in ceremonies to honor deities or invoke spiritual blessings.
In Christianity, the white flame is associated with the Holy Spirit and divine presence. It symbolizes purity of heart and the light of God’s wisdom. Similarly, in Hinduism, the white flame is linked to Agni, the fire god, who represents transformation and purification. In Japanese culture, white flames are seen as symbols of ancestral spirits and divine protection.

White Flame Meditation Techniques
Meditating with the white flame meaning in mind can be a transformative experience. By visualizing a white flame, you can tap into its purifying and enlightening energy to promote inner peace and spiritual growth.
Begin by finding a quiet space where you won’t be disturbed. Close your eyes and take a few deep breaths to center yourself. Visualize a white flame glowing brightly in front of you. Allow its light to envelop your body, cleansing and purifying your energy field.

White Flame in Candle Magic
In candle magic, the white flame meaning is often associated with purity, protection, and spiritual guidance. White candles are commonly used in rituals to invoke divine blessings, cleanse negative energies, and promote healing.
To perform a simple white flame ritual, light a white candle and focus on your intention. Visualize the flame amplifying your energy and sending your desires into the universe. Allow the candle to burn completely, symbolizing the release of your intention.
